Ok, so Im syncing the sequencer to my DAW, using the Pro3 as slave.
I type in some notes on the DAW to transpose the sequence and press space bar. Everything works fine.
When I sweep through the main filter knob I get these mad dips in volume, almost as if their is a broken or dodgy connection.
(There are no modulations going to the filter from within the synth)

Is anyone else experiencing this?

Further development:

I am using Logic Pro X.

The problem goes away when the record arm is taken off the External Instrument channel.
Title: Re: Volume dips when using filter receiving Midi notes from Logic
Post by: ensoniq70 on March 25, 2020, 08:43:24 AM
USB MIDI is buggy in Version 1. The most of the knobs send cc 7 if you move them. Sequential knows this bug. If you use the midi jacks, all works fine.
